This closer has been caused by the homeless once again. Fall Cr area is a place they go. The Forest Service probably knows who even made the mess, especially if they were doing their job. All places have a 14 day limit, yet the picture that was shown on the news was 6 months of trash.
I'm betting the Forest Service just wanted an excuse to close the dispersed areas and this was their ticket. They were all on furlough and came back to work to find out they should not have been on furlough.

I cannot imagine why people wouldn't want to clean up after themselves. Maybe it's the ability to do so. Volunteering as a camp ground host we spend a good deal of time litter picking. Most campers do a good job of pack it in pack it out, some not so much. Maybe you guys can figure this one out, the two items we pick up the most; juice cup straw covers and cigarette butts. Makes you wonder.
I don't think trash in the dispersed areas is coming from campers, at least not the version we are familiar with. Even VanLifers pick up after themselves. I think the trash is coming from our growing population of impoverished persons. And that population is growing. They have zero supporting infrastructure, as a result they have no trash service, so they leave their trash laying.
I truly wish I had a solution.Dallas

While it is true some homeless leave trash around rather than dispose of it properly, creating a mess, it is unfair to say or imply all homeless are irresponsible, don't care etc. and try to separate the homeless from RV'ers who use their rigs for recreation or those who full-time. Case in point there is a large parking lot of a temporarily closed facility near the RV park we are currently staying in that has a number of homeless staying there, some in run down RV's and some in cars. I have yet to see any trash left behind and the waste barrels show signs of being used. On the other hand I have seen plenty of examples of irresponsible and thoughtless RV'ers who fail to pick up after their dogs despite signs indicating so and pet waste stations at hand. I have seen numerous times of non flammable trash left in fire rings left by RV'ers, left for CG staff or volunteers to pick-up and dispose of.
